An Extension Study to Assess Long-Term Safety and Efficacy of Afimkibart in Participants with Rheumatoid Arthritis

EU CTIS ID: 2025-523579-47-00

What this study is testing

To evaluate the long-term safety and tolerability of afimkibart

Who can take part

You may be able to join if

  • Completed the treatment period of the parent study
  • Agreement to adhere to the contraception requirements
  • Continued to be evaluated at the follow-up visit of the parent study and achieved ≥ 20%improvement in the Swollen Joint Count (SJC)66/ Tender Joint Count (TJC)68 relative to baseline

You likely can't join if

  • Withdrawal of consent and/or premature discontinuation from parent study
  • Any permanent discontinuation of study drug in parent study
  • Use of a prohibited therapy during the parent study
  • Evidence of any new or uncontrolled concomitant disease that, in the investigator’s judgment, would preclude participant participation in the trial

The study team makes the final eligibility decision.
